Liverpool may have been handed a boost in their attempts to land a player who shined at Euro 2024 this summer.

Arne Slot is yet to bolster his squad after taking over from Jurgen Klopp but the Reds continue to be linked with moves for a host of stars.

Klopp left behind an incredibly talented side but the Dutchman will surely be keen for Liverpool to address a couple of key areas.

One potential problem for Slot could be the wide forward areas, with Luis Diaz reportedly keen to secure a dream move to Barcelona.

The Colombian's departure would leave Slot needing another option out wide while Mohamed Salah's long-term future at Anfield is also far from certain.

Among their most high-profile forward targets is Napoli star Khvicha Kvaratskhelia, with the Georgian winger's agent recently claiming he wants a move this summer.

Liverpool have been long linked with a move for the talented winger and it was claimed just last month that Slot's men have enquired about signing him.

Now, a FIFA agent has tipped Kvaratskhelia to secure a move to England or France.

Juventus forward Federico Chiesa has emerged as a target for new Napoli boss Antonio Conte.

FIFA agent, Serxhio Mezi, has been discussing Kvaratskhelia's future and feels Chiesa could replace the Napoli star.

“The only team in Italy that wants Federico Chiesa is Conte’s Napoli," Mezi said. "The exterior is part of a request list drawn up by the technician. To tell the truth, I see him very well in the Napoli of the former Juve and Inter man.”

He added: “He had a very good European Championship (Kvara) and I see him away from Napoli, in France or England. For this reason, we could say that Chiesa is his replacement, starting next season," as quoted by Tutto Juve.

With interest in Kvaratskhelia growing, it's been claimed that the Napoli star has already rejected the chance to join Ligue 1 giants PSG.

The £100 million-rated forward is said to favour a move to England but whether or not he gets his wish is unclear.

Fabrizio Romano has already stated that the Naples club have no intention of selling their star man this summer, particularly with Victor Osimhen likely to leave.

Conte is particularly keen to keep hold of Kvaratskhelia and Napoli are set to offer the winger a new contract.
